I have the Quick Release bracket installed on the beams I've bolted in, and I use a small masterlock in there to deter theft...


It's 24 volt so I had to get a Yandina Combiner and ran 1ga from the combiner to the front.  I took it off for storage so I had to cut my wires so I will probably install some type of waterproof plug.
 
On drilling through the premium vinyl, I would use a sharpie to mark the location and then get a new utility knife blade and pre-cut a slightly larger perimeter to reduce the snagging effect on the strands.

Just use a snowmobile track stud drill bit, they come in a few different sizes and have no teeth. Will cut tight thru the vinyl and give you a smooth edge around the hole. Oh yeah,that'll work on carpet too!
